LMMS
Loading...
Searching...
No Matches
clap_plugin_params Struct Reference

#include <params.h>

Public Member Functions

 uint32_t (CLAP_ABI *count)(const clap_plugin_t *plugin)
 bool (CLAP_ABI *get_info)(const clap_plugin_t *plugin
 bool (CLAP_ABI *get_value)(const clap_plugin_t *plugin
 bool (CLAP_ABI *value_to_text)(const clap_plugin_t *plugin
 bool (CLAP_ABI *text_to_value)(const clap_plugin_t *plugin
 void (CLAP_ABI *flush)(const clap_plugin_t *plugin

Public Attributes

uint32_t param_index
uint32_t clap_param_info_tparam_info
clap_id param_id
clap_id double * value
clap_id double value
clap_id double char * display
clap_id double char uint32_t size
clap_id const char * display
clap_id const char double * value
const clap_input_events_tin
const clap_input_events_t const clap_output_events_tout

Member Function Documentation

◆ bool() [1/4]

clap_plugin_params::bool ( CLAP_ABI * get_info) const

◆ bool() [2/4]

clap_plugin_params::bool ( CLAP_ABI * get_value) const

◆ bool() [3/4]

clap_plugin_params::bool ( CLAP_ABI * text_to_value) const

◆ bool() [4/4]

clap_plugin_params::bool ( CLAP_ABI * value_to_text) const

◆ uint32_t()

clap_plugin_params::uint32_t ( CLAP_ABI * count) const

◆ void()

clap_plugin_params::void ( CLAP_ABI * flush) const

Member Data Documentation

◆ display [1/2]

clap_id const char* clap_plugin_params::display

◆ display [2/2]

clap_id double char* clap_plugin_params::display

◆ in

const clap_input_events_t* clap_plugin_params::in

◆ out

◆ param_id

clap_id clap_plugin_params::param_id

◆ param_index

uint32_t clap_plugin_params::param_index

◆ param_info

uint32_t clap_param_info_t* clap_plugin_params::param_info

◆ size

clap_id double char uint32_t clap_plugin_params::size

◆ value [1/3]

clap_id const char double* clap_plugin_params::value

◆ value [2/3]

clap_id double clap_plugin_params::value

◆ value [3/3]

clap_id double* clap_plugin_params::value

The documentation for this struct was generated from the following file: